Well, it only too only day for the NHL commissioner to get to Salt Lake and
burst the bubble for all us idealists. According to Bettman (I saw it in
the Boston Herald today, couldn't get the link), the play we are seeing in
the Olympics has nothing to do with the size of the rink or the elimination
of the two line pass. For him, it is just the skill of the players. I
would like to ask Mr. Bettman why, with the same players, the play in his
league is so unexciting. He did concede that he liked the 15 second
face-off rule, "something to consider", he says. Thanks for the bone.
